About Green Dot Labs:
Green Dot Labs is a premier consumer cannabis brand, an industry pioneer, a leader in the Colorado adult-use market, and a soon-to-be leader in Arizona (entering in 2025).
Green Dot Labs was formally established in 2014, but its roots trace back to 2008 when husband and wife founders Dave and Alana Malone began their journey in the state’s medical market. Since then, the Green Dot Labs team has tirelessly refined and honed its exceptional, ultra-premium cultivation model – marking its dedication to producing the purest reflections of cannabis’ abundant potential flavors, effects, and wellness benefits.
Green Dot Labs’ tireless work has paid off, earning the brand an obsessive following among the most discerning cannabis consumers. According to BDSA, in 2023 Green Dot Labs was Colorado’s #1 Selling Premium Brand, #1 Selling Brand Overall, #1 Selling Concentrates Brand, #1 Selling Ultra-Premium Flower Brand, #1 Selling Live Resin Brand, and the state’s #1 Selling Live Resin Vape Brand as well.
Green Dot Labs will begin offering its enormous, growing, world-class library of exclusive strains to cannabis lovers in Arizona in September 2025.

Compliance & Regulations:
- Maintain detailed knowledge of all GDL policies, procedures, SOPs and quality standards pertaining to packaging, QC, order fulfillment and inventory
- Maintain confident comprehension and ensure compliance with Department of Health Services Adult-Use Marijuana Program regulations as they apply to cannabis production and delivery, including but not limited to:
- R9-18-308 – Administration
- R9-18-309 – Selling or Otherwise Transferring Marijuana or Marijuana Product
- R9-18-310 – Product Labeling and Packaging
- R9-18-311 – Analysis of Marijuana or Marijuana Product
- R9-18-312 – Security
- R9-18-312.01 – Delivery to Consumers
- R9-18-314 – Inventory Control System
